The Scottish oil-shale industry from the viewpoint of the modern-day shale-gas industry
Abstract Oil production in West Lothian in Scotland started in 1851. It was not the first place to produce oil from shale but it was the largest and most successful. This oil production led to major developments in oil refining and, as a result, a large demand for oil products was created. This new demand for oil products stimulated the search for oil around the world and resulted in the first modern-day oil well being drilled in Titusville Pennsylvania in 1859. Over the next 100 years, an estimated 75 MMbbl (million barrels) of oil and 500 Bcf (billion cubic ft) of gas were produced from the shales of West Lothian. Initially, the oil was produced from a thin layer of shale at Torbanehill near Bathgate. Later, the much thicker deposits in the Dinantian West Lothian Oil-shale Formation (WLO) were used to produce the oil, although there was also oil produced from other shales mostly in the Lower Coal Measures and Limestone Coal Formation. This paper looks at the Scottish oil-shale industry from the viewpoint of the modern-day shale-gas industry and highlights the contribution the industry made as the forerunner of the oil industry. The paper attempts to explain why the Scottish oil-shale industry was so successful and influential. Reasons why the oil-shale industry did not develop into modern oil-well production are also put forward. The Scottish shale-oil industry was successful not only thanks to James Young and his colleagues but also because of the geology of the Central Belt of Scotland and, in particular, the geochemical properties of the WLO. The shale-oil industry, natural oil seepage, free oil encountered during mining and the historical exploration drilling demonstrate a rich functioning source rock suggesting significant prospectivity for future exploration for both oil fields and shale gas.
The birth and development of the oil and gas industry in the Northern Carpathians (up until 1939)
Abstract The northern segments of the Carpathians, stretching between Limanowa (Poland) and Kosów (Ukraine), belonged to the most prolific hydrocarbon province in the world in the late nineteenth and early twentieth centuries. The earliest written accounts of natural occurrences of hydrocarbons in the Carpathians date back to the sixteenth century. In the eighteenth and early nineteenth centuries, Rzączyński, Kluk, Hacquest and Staszic provided accounts on methods of practical use related to oil. Staszic’s geological map shows numerous oil seeps and different rock types containing hydrocarbons. The development of the oil industry was triggered by Łukasiewicz’s discovery of an oil-distillation process and the construction of a kerosene lamp. Following this, the oil industry flourished in the Northern Carpathians. Oil production peaked at 2 Mt (million tons) of crude oil in 1910. In subsequent years, the level of oil production steadily decreased due to a turbulent economy. Exploration for oil, gas and ozokerite resulted in the development of modern micropalaeontology and geological mapping, with a prime example being the regional coverage of almost the entire Northern Carpathians provided by the Atlas Geologiczny Galicyi ( Geological Atlas of Galicia ), which consisted of 99 high-quality geological maps at a scale of 1:75 000. Geophysical surveying techniques were applied to subsurface mapping, and higher educational institutions were established in order to support exploration efforts.
The history of the upstream oil and gas industry in Italy
Abstract The aim of this work is to provide a synthetic history of the Italian upstream oil and gas industry, from its early start until today. Among European countries, Italy has one of the richest abundance of evidence of hydrocarbon seepages. The populations that have inhabited the country during the various historical periods took advantage of these phenomena, harvesting oil and bitumen from the surface. A testimony of such activity is an ingot of purified bitumen dated as first century AD found in central Italy. In the nineteenth century, seepages attracted the interest of oil companies that began to explore the Apennines. The drilling of the first modern oil well was realized in 1860 near Ozzano (Parma). The first onshore seismic reflection survey was acquired in 1940. The well Caviaga-1 was drilled in 1944 near Milan, discovering a gas field of 12.5 Bcm. It was one of the major European gas fields and it marked the starting point of the modern Italian petroleum industry. The widespread use of seismic reflection triggered an intense period of exploration. The first material oil discoveries were Ragusa (in 1954) and Gela (in 1956), both in Sicily. By the mid-1950s, the first offshore seismic survey started in the Adriatic Sea. In 1959, the drilling of well Gela 21, the first offshore well in Europe, boosted further exploration possibilities. During the following decades, the level of exploration and production (E&P) activities remained high, while from the beginning of the third millennium there has been a general slowdown. Since 2007, the level of exploration drilling has dropped to under 10 wells per year. In 2014, this negative trend was further confirmed with no exploratory wells drilled. The causes of this decline derive from the exploration maturity of the biogenic gas play and from the heavy bureaucratic processes involved in obtaining authorization. However, the main cause is probably the strong opposition from environmentalist associations to any kind of petroleum activities.
